In October 2014, the Consumer


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B) adopted a rule that allows financial institutions


that do not engage rather than in


certain types of information-sharing to post their annual privacy notices online


delivering them


individually. In these circumstances, consumers also must be able to call a toll-free number to request a paper copy of the privacy disclosure.

To find out who regulates a financial institution (the FDIC is not the primary regulator for all of the institutions it insures), you can call the FDIC toll-free at 1-877-ASK-FDIC (1-877- 275-3342).


"Remember that privacy practices


differ at various financial institutions," said Ed Nygard, a Senior Consumer Affairs


Specialist at the FDIC. "If


you are uncomfortable with the way your information will be treated at one institution, you may wish to shop around for a different one."


You also have the right to


prohibit credit bureaus from providing information about you to lenders and insurers that want to send you unsolicited offers of credit or insurance. To remove yourself from marketing lists sold by credit bureaus, call toll-free 1-888-567-8688 or go to www.optoutprescreen.com.

lingering uncertainty about the future of the Open Internet, the Federal Communications Commission has set sustainable rules of the roads that will protect free expression and innovation on the Internet and promote investment in the nation’s broadband networks. The FCC has long been committed to protecting and promoting an Internet that nurtures freedom of speech and expression, supports innovation and commerce, and incentivizes expansion and investment by


America’s


broadband providers. But the agency’s attempts to implement enforceable, sustainable rules to protect the Open Internet have been twice struck down by the courts. The Commission—once and for all—enacts strong, sustainable


rules, grounded in multiple sources of legal authority, to ensure that Americans reap the economic, social, and civic benefits of an Open Internet today and into the future. These new rules are guided by three principles: America’s broadband networks must be fast, fair and open—principles shared by the overwhelming majority of the nearly 4 million commenters who participated in the FCC’s Open Internet proceeding. Absent action by the FCC, Internet openness is at risk, as recognized by the very court that struck down the FCC’s 2010 Open Internet


rules last year in Verizon


v. FCC. Broadband providers have economic incentives that “represent a threat to Internet openness and could act
